找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 1507|回复: 0
打印 上一主题 下一主题
收起左侧

51单片机流水灯积累源码

[复制链接]
跳转到指定楼层
楼主
ID:330757 发表于 2018-6-8 20:56 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
Text1.rar (399 Bytes, 下载次数: 5)

请尊重作者劳动,仅供学习参考谢谢!

单片机源码:
  1. #include<reg52.h>
  2. #define uchar unsigned char
  3. void delay()
  4. {
  5.     uchar i,j;
  6.         for(i=0;i<255;i++)
  7.     for(j=0;j<255;j++);
  8. }

  9. void main()
  10. {
  11.         uchar temp1,temp2,temp3,f1,f2,f3;
  12.     P1=0XFF;
  13.         while(1)
  14.     {      
  15.                         f3=7;
  16.                         temp1=0x00;
  17.             temp2=0x80;
  18.                         temp3=0x01;
  19.          for(f2=0;f2<8;f2++)
  20.                   {        
  21.                                 temp3=0x01;
  22.                                
  23.                             for(f1=0;f1<f3;f1++)
  24.                             {   
  25.                                         //P1=~(temp1|0x00);
  26.                                         //delay();
  27.                                         P1=~(temp3|temp1);
  28.                                         delay();
  29.                                         temp3=temp3<<1;
  30.                                         P1=~(temp3|temp1);
  31.                                         delay();
  32.                                 }
  33.                
  34.                                    //temp1=temp1&temp2;
  35.                                 temp1=temp1|temp2;
  36.                             temp2=temp2>>1;
  37.                                
  38.                                
  39.                                 f3--;
  40.      
  41.                }
  42.         }
  43. }
复制代码

所有资料51hei提供下载:



分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 分享淘帖 顶 踩
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表